About Paul Germonpré
Paul Germonpré is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Oncology, Molecular Biology, Physiology and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, having authored 68 papers that have together received 2.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Lung Cancer Treatments and Mutations (20 papers), Occupational and environmental lung diseases (9 papers), Respiratory Support and Mechanisms (6 papers), Neuropeptides and Animal Physiology (6 papers), Colorectal Cancer Treatments and Studies (5 papers), Lung Cancer Research Studies (5 papers),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) Research (5 papers) and Asthma and respiratory diseases (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(1.4k citations), Oncology (554 citations), Physiology (345 citations), Cancer Research (179 citations) and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(217 citations). Paul Germonpré has collaborated with scholars based in Belgium, United States and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Guy Joos, Ruben Pauwels, Wilfried De Backer, Wim Vos, Paul M. Parizel, Jan W. De Backer, Wilfried Eberhardt, Floris L. Wuyts, Bethany Sleckman and Naiyer A. Rizvi.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Journal of Thoracic Oncology, Lung Cancer, International Journal of COPD and European Respiratory Journal.
